循环队列
-
C++怎么实现一个循环队列_C++数据结构与数组实现队列
循环队列通过数组和头尾指针实现环形结构,解决假溢出问题。1. 使用front指向队首元素,rear指向下一个插入位置;2. 队满条件为(rear+1)%capacity==front,队空为rear==front;3. 数组容量设为n+1以区分满和空状态;4. 入队时更新rear=(rear+1)%…
*本站广告为第三方投放,如发生纠纷,请向本站索取第三方联系方式沟通
循环队列通过数组和头尾指针实现环形结构,解决假溢出问题。1. 使用front指向队首元素,rear指向下一个插入位置;2. 队满条件为(rear+1)%capacity==front,队空为rear==front;3. 数组容量设为n+1以区分满和空状态;4. 入队时更新rear=(rear+1)%…